About Xun Luo

Xun Luo is a scholar working on Transplantation, Hepatology and Nephrology, having authored 71 papers that have together received 2.2k indexed citations. Recurring topics across this work include Organ Transplantation Techniques and Outcomes (32 papers), Renal Transplantation Outcomes and Treatments (25 papers) and Organ Donation and Transplantation (25 papers). The work is most often cited by research in Transplantation (1.2k citations), Hepatology (484 citations) and Nephrology (315 citations). Xun Luo has collaborated with scholars based in United States, China and Canada. Frequent co-authors include Dorry L. Segev, Allan B. Massie, Niraj M. Desai, Eric K.H. Chow, Lauren M. Kucirka, Sunjae Bae, Macey L. Henderson, Mary G. Bowring, Tanjala S. Purnell and Jennifer L. Alejo. Their work appears in journals such as JAMA, Journal of Clinical Oncology and Gastroenterology.
